Dairy Doctors Veterinary Services Scholarship Program
Dairy Doctors Veterinary Services has been offering two to four scholarships each year since 2006, totaling more than $15,000, to high school seniors aspiring to build a career in the dairy industry. Any student planning a career in dairy, either in veterinary medicine or in numerous related fields, such as producer, genetic science field or other agriculture-related field is eligible. Selection will be based on their academic accomplishments, community involvement, extracurricular activities, and career goals.
